Hoxton Station is well-equipped to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ey. The ticket office operates Monday to Friday from 07:30 to 10:00, catering to morning commuters. 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ets, an accessible choice for those who prefer to skip the queues. With a strong focus on accessibility, the station offers step-free access throughout, making travel convenient for everyone. Additionally, acc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and ramps facilitate effortless navigation, while wheelchairs are available for passengers in need of extra assistance.
Although waiting rooms and seating areas are unavailable, amenities like vending machines on the concourse provide refreshments. Commuters will be pleased to know that public Wi-Fi is available, ensuring connectivity on the go. While there are no shops or ATM facilities, the focus remains on functional efficiency.
Hoxton Station is well-integrated with other modes of transport, ensuring you can continue your journey smoothly. Bus stops are strategically placed, with southbound services to New Cross/New Cross Gate accessible at bus stop KN and northbound services to Dalston Junction/Dalston Kingsland at bus stop KA. Although Morden South does not have a ticket office, passengers can easily obtain tickets through the available ticket machines. These are user-friendly and acc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ring that purchasing tickets remains an accessible experience. For tech-savvy travelers, smartcard validators are also present, helping to streamline your journey.
There's a notable lack of facilities such as toilets, baby changing areas, and shops at the station. However, it does provide a seating area and a CCTV-secured bicycle stand for those who cycle to the station. Assistance for travelers who require extra help isn't absent; support can be arranged through the help points located on the platforms or by pre-booking assisted travel.
It's important to note that Morden South lacks step-free access, categorizing it as a Category C station. This could pose challenges for travelers with mobility issues. Despite this, the station has a dedicated Assistance Meeting Point by the entrance for those needing help. Be it needing guidance or requiring aid to board a train, the station's assistance facilities are always ready to serve when prearranged.
